The core strengths of the hybrid cloud model are powerful and directly address the primary concerns of modern enterprises. Its greatest strength is flexibility. The model allows organizations to strategically place workloads in the most appropriate environment based on their specific requirements for performance, security, cost, and compliance, offering a "best of both worlds" solution. This agility enables businesses to respond quickly to new opportunities while maintaining control over their core assets. A second major strength is cost optimization. By balancing the use of on-premises infrastructure (for stable, predictable workloads) with the pay-as-you-go public cloud (for variable, bursty workloads), companies can achieve a lower total cost of ownership (TCO) compared to a pure-play approach. Another key strength is enhanced security and compliance. Hybrid cloud allows organizations to keep their most sensitive data and regulated workloads within their own private data centers, behind their own firewalls, while still being able to leverage the innovative services of the public cloud for less sensitive applications. This addresses major concerns around data sovereignty and regulatory mandates like GDPR and HIPAA.
Despite its compelling strengths, the hybrid cloud model also has significant weaknesses that organizations must address. The most prominent weakness is complexity. Managing a hybrid environment that spans on-premises data centers, private clouds, and one or more public clouds is inherently more complex than managing a single environment. It requires new tools, new skills, and a new operational model. This complexity can lead to challenges in areas like network connectivity, security policy enforcement, and performance monitoring across disparate platforms. Another weakness is the potential for increased costs if not managed properly. While the model offers opportunities for cost optimization, it can also lead to "cloud sprawl" and unexpected expenses related to data egress fees (the cost of moving data out of a public cloud) and the overhead of managing multiple environments. Finally, finding and retaining talent with the broad skillset required to manage a hybrid environment—spanning networking, security, cloud architecture, and container orchestration—can be a significant challenge for many organizations, creating a skills gap that can hinder successful implementation.
The external environment presents a wealth of opportunities for the hybrid cloud market, but also notable threats. The biggest opportunity lies in the rise of edge computing. As more data is generated and processed at the edge, the hybrid model provides the perfect architecture to manage this distributed infrastructure, with the central cloud providing management and analytics. The continued growth of AI/ML and big data analytics also presents a huge opportunity, as organizations can use the scalable public cloud for compute-intensive model training while keeping their proprietary datasets secure on-premises. However, the market also faces threats. The primary threat is security. A hybrid environment has a larger and more complex attack surface than a single data center, creating more potential points of entry for malicious actors. Misconfigurations in the complex interplay between public and private clouds can lead to serious security vulnerabilities. Another threat is vendor lock-in. While hybrid cloud promises flexibility, choosing a specific hybrid platform from a major vendor can still lead to a form of lock-in, making it difficult and costly to switch to a different platform in the future. Navigating these external factors will be key to realizing the long-term value of the hybrid cloud.
